Yapay Zeka Destekli Oyun Tasarımı: Etkileyici Deneyimler Yaratma
Yapay Zeka Destekli Oyun Tasarımı: Etkileyici Deneyimler Yaratma
Günümüzde oyun sektörü, teknolojinin gelişimi ile birlikte sürekli bir evrim geçiriyor. Yapay zeka (AI) kullanımı, oyun tasarımını yeniden şekillendiriyor. Yapay zeka, oyuncu deneyimlerini geliştiren akıllı sistemler sunuyor. Oyun geliştiricileri, AI sayesinde daha etkileyici ve sürükleyici deneyimler yaratabilme kapasitesine sahip oluyor. Yapay zeka, karakter davranışlarından seviyeye kadar birçok unsuru optimize etmek için kullanılıyor. Bu yazıda, yapay zekanın ne olduğu, oyun tasarımında nasıl kullanıldığı, sürükleyici oyun deneyimlerinin nasıl yaratıldığı ve gelecekteki oyun geliştirme yöntemlerine dair önemli bilgiler sunuluyor.
Yapay Zeka Nedir?
Yapay zeka, insanların zeka süreçlerini taklit eden bir teknoloji alanıdır. Bu teknolojiler, bilgisayar sistemlerinin öğrenme, problem çözme, algılama ve dil anlama gibi yetenekleri geliştirmesine olanak tanır. Yapay zeka, makine öğrenimi ve derin öğrenme gibi yöntemler kullanarak karmaşık sorunları çözme yeteneği kazanır. Bu durum, oyun geliştirme sürecinde özel bir öneme sahip olmasını sağlar. Geliştiriciler, AI kullanarak oyun dünyasında akıllı ve dinamik unsurlar oluşturabilir. Bununla birlikte, oyuncunun kararlarına göre şekillenen hikaye ve ortamlar yaratmak mümkün hale gelir.
AI, oyun tasarımında yalnızca teknik bir araç değil, aynı zamanda bir yaratıcılık kaynağıdır. Geliştiriciler, yapay zekanın sunduğu veri analiz yeteneklerini kullanarak oyuncu davranışlarına yönelik sonuçlar çıkarır. Bu sayede, oyuncunun ihtiyaçlarına uygun içerikler sunmak mümkün olur. Örneğin, bir oyunda oyuncunun nasıl davrandığına dair analizler yapılabilir. Bu veriler, oyun içindeki zorluk seviyelerini ve karakter tepkilerini optimize etmeye yardımcı olur. Dolayısıyla, AI oyun geliştirmede devrimsel bir rol üstlenir.
Oyun Tasarımında AI Kullanımı
Oyun tasarımında yapay zeka kullanımı, birçok yönü kapsar. İlk olarak, NPC (Non-Playable Character) davranışlarını geliştirmek için yapay zeka teknikleri kullanılır. Örneğin, bir savaş oyununda düşman karakterleri, oyuncunun hareketlerine tepki verir. İyi tasarlanmış bir AI, düşmanın hareketlerini akıllıca belirler. Bu sayede, oyuncuya zorlu ve eğlenceli bir deneyim sunar. Yapay zeka, oyunculara benzersiz ve meydan okuyan bir deneyim yaratmayı hedefler. Bu tür dinamiklik, oyuncunun oyunun içine daha fazla çekilmesini sağlar.
İkinci olarak, yapay zeka ile oyunların zorluk düzeyleri dinamik olarak ayarlanabilir. Örneğin, bazı oyunlar, oyuncunun performansına göre zorluk seviyesini otomatik olarak değiştirebilir. Eğer oyuncu oyunu çok kolay buluyorsa, yapay zeka zorluk düzeyini artırır. Bu güncel oynamayı teşvik eder. Yapılan araştırmalara göre, AI kullanımı ile oyuncuların oyunlara bağlılık oranları artmaktadır. Oyuncular, zorluk seviyelerinin sürekli değişkenliğiyle daha fazla motive olurlar. Böylece, uzun süreli etkileşim sağlanabilir.
Sürükleyici Oyun Deneyimleri
Sürükleyici oyun deneyimleri yaratmak için birçok faktör göz önünde bulundurulur. Yapay zeka, bu faktörlerin başında gelir. AI, oyuncuların hislerini derinlemesine anlayarak dinamik tepkiler oluşturur. Örneğin, eğitim alanında kullanılan yapay zeka, oyuncunun öğrenme hızına göre zorlukları ayarlayabilir. Bu durum, oyuncuların deneyimlerinin daha kişiselleştirilmiş olmasını sağlar. Dolayısıyla, atmosfer ve hikaye akışı üzerinde daha derin bir etki yaratır.
Sürükleyiciliği artırmanın bir diğer yolu, oyuncuya seçim yapma imkanları sunmaktır. Oyuncular, kararlarından sonuçlar çıkararak hikayenin gidişatını belirler. Örneğin, bir rol yapma oyununda yapay zeka ile desteklenen diyalog sistemleri, oyuncunun seçimlerine dayalı olarak farklı sonuçlar doğurabilir. Bu durum, oyuncunun karar alma sürecini etkiler. Sonuç olarak, bu tür sistemler, oyuncunun oyunla kurduğu bağı güçlendirir ve kalıcı bir deneyim sunar.
Geleceğin Oyun Geliştirme Yöntemleri
Gelecekte, yapay zekanın oyun geliştirme yöntemlerine yönelik etkileri giderek daha belirgin hale geliyor. Oyun tasarımında AI, daha özelleştirilmiş ve kişiselleştirilmiş deneyimlerin yaratılmasını sağlar. Bu durum, oyuncularda daha yüksek bir memnuniyet seviyesi doğurur. Yapay zeka, veri analitiği kullanarak oyuncu davranışlarını takip eder. Böylece geliştirilmesi gereken noktaları belirler ve uygun çözümler sunar. Oyun geliştiricileri, bu verileri kullanarak daha iyi oyun deneyimleri oluşturmayı hedefler.
Dijital dünyada daha etkileyici deneyimler sunmak için AI teknolojisinin yenilikleri takip edilir. Sanal gerçeklik ve artırılmış gerçeklik gibi teknolojiler, yapay zekanın potansiyeli ile birleşerek oyun deneyimlerini daha da geliştirebilir. Bu durum, oyuncuların oyun içindeki dünyayla etkileşim düzeyini artırır. İleri düzey yapay zeka sistemleri, oyunların dinamik yapısını oluşturarak daha derin bir deneyim sunma potansiyeline sahiptir. Bunun sonucu olarak, yeni nesil oyunlar sürekli bir evrim içerisinde olacaktır.
- Yapay Zeka ile Dinamik NPC Davranışları
- Oyun İçi Zorluk Düzeyinin Ayarlanması
- Özelleştirilmiş Oyun Deneyimleri
- Veri Analitiği ile Karar Alma Süreçleri
- Yeni Teknolojilerin Entegrasyonu